Visually, a premium-quality PNG file is essential for professional work. Unlike JPEGs, which leave you with that jagged white box around your design, a transparent background allows the art to blend seamlessly into your canvas. Whether you are placing this over a distressed texture for a vintage t-shirt look or layering it over a sleek gradient for a digital banner, the transparency ensures the design looks native to its environment.

The resolution matters, too. At 300 DPI (dots per inch), this design is print-ready. This is the industry standard for high-quality physical products. If you have ever tried to print a low-resolution image found on a search engine onto a t-shirt, you know the disappointment of the "pixelated" look. With this asset, the lines are crisp, the curves are smooth, and the text remains legible even when scaled up for larger formats like posters or home décor. It is the difference between a hobbyist experiment and a professional-grade product.

Design Versatility: Pairing and Presentation

One of the challenges with display fonts or bold graphic text is finding the right balance. Because "They Not Like Us" is a strong, declarative statement, it acts as a visual anchor. When you are building your layout, let this element be the star. If you are creating a poster, you do not need to clutter the space with ten other elements. Let the typography breathe.

If you are layering this PNG over photography, look for images with "negative space"—areas of the photo that are less busy, like a clear sky or a solid wall. This ensures the text remains readable. Readability is the cornerstone of effective design. A design can be beautiful, but if the audience has to squint to read it, the message is lost.
